Animals are not actors, circus clowns, athletes, slaves or spectacles to be imprisoned and gawked at. Yet humans confine thousands of animals to barren, boring and filthy enclosures. Living in captivity destroys the social and emotional relationships these animals need to thrive. Animals are crammed into boxcars or semi-trailers and carted across the country, all for the sake of human “entertainment”. Under threat of physical punishment, many animals are forced to perform against their will. Some of these animals even pay with their lives. All forms of entertainment in which animals are bred, raised, bought, sold, caught and used for human entertainment are wrong! Rodeos, horse racing, dog racing, circuses, zoos, aquariums, dog fighting, fishing, hunting and bullfighting are just some examples.
